Attempting to summit Oregon's third highest peak, along with three of my kids, was one of the most painful, exhilarating, exhausting, rewarding, and humbling things I have ever done. Sounds like life and leadership in these extremely challenging days, doesn't it?Are you getting weary and worn out?Are you feeling beat up and ready to quit?Are you looking for some encouragement for your soul?Take a journey with John Fehlen, and the prophet Elijah, in discovering a supernatural source of strength, as well as practical steps for whatever "climb" you may be facing. Don't Give Up is a must-read in these difficult and wearisome days. I have known John for more than two decades and he has weathered some difficult days with his faith, his family, and his joy intact. As a long-time Central Oregonian I have climbed the South Sister a dozen or more times and it is as hard as John describes. My last hike up that mountain ended up being a metaphor for the journey back to faith after the death of my oldest son. In this book you will find encouragement to keep pressing forward, to not give up, and to find joy in the journey. - Steve Mickel, pastor and author of Walking in the Dark Fellow travelers need each other on this strange journey we are embarking on. John is one of those travelers who has written an honest, vulnerable and encouraging word to us all.
